HIGHSIDER PROTON MODUL 3in1 LED rear light, brake light, turn signal, E-approved for rear.
– Small, smaller, HIGHSIDER PROTON –

With a HIGHSIDER PROTON MODULE for laminating or gluing in, the turn signal component on the motorcycle can virtually disappear optically. This indicator is only noticeable when it really has to be. The trend towards ever smaller lighting elements makes it possible to give the bike a cool and clean look. Put an end to the oversized torchlight systems from the times of our ancestors. The next level down has been reached and opens up completely new design options on the motorcycle.

Dimensions:
A Diameter: 11 mm
B Width (depth): 13 mm
Weight: 4 g

Connections:
Yellow = taillight (+)
Red = brake light (+)
Brown = turn signal (+)
Black = ground (-)

Scope of delivery: 1 pair.

Why?
It is possible that when you install your new turn signal, the flashing frequency no longer fits or an error code appears in the cockpit.

Solution:
1. Enter here the original flasher power (in watts). You will then receive a suggestion for a suitable* resistor that fixes the described problem.
2. or use one of our load-independent flasher relays.
